“Let It Rain”: A Song of Guilt and Healing
In this segment from the Mark Winters show, Chris and Mike go deeper into the meaning behind “Let It Rain”—not just as a song, but as an emotional release. What sounds simple on the surface carries a heavy undercurrent of guilt, reflection, and the need to let go of what’s been weighing you down.
Mark shares how the song became a way to process those feelings. Guilt has a way of sticking around, replaying moments, questioning decisions—but instead of burying it, this song leans into it. “Let it rain” becomes symbolic—letting the emotion fall, washing through instead of holding it back. That’s where the healing begins.
Chris and Mike connect it to something universal. Everyone carries something—regret, loss, things left unsaid. The difference is whether you suppress it or face it. Music, in this case, becomes the outlet that turns pain into something meaningful.
It’s raw, honest, and one of those reminders that sometimes healing doesn’t come from fixing the past—it comes from finally letting it out.
